Weds | 5. 8. 19 receptive fields (in the retina) Frequency (hz): number of full waves per second. Complexity: for sounds containing 2 or more frequencies (i. e. , any natural sound), the distinct profile of amplitudes across frequencies. The timbre is the quality that distinguishes between two sounds that have the same loudness, pitch and duration but still sound different (e. g. , same not on a piano and violin) Why has auto-tune taken over the music industry: britney spears" best friend . Or if you want to sing in a robot voice. Inner ear: semicircular canals: maintenance of posture and balance, the cochlea: the structure transducing sound waves into electrical (neural) info. Two types of receptors: inner and outer hair cells: the hidden beauty of outer hair cells. In humans: ~3,500 inner hair cells, ~15,000 - 20,000 outer hair cells, hair cell has stereocilia (hair)
